The Royal Society's mission is to recognise, promote and support excellence in science and to encourage the development and use of science for the benefit of humanity. To support its mission the Society hosts and organises a number of scientific, policy and other meetings and public events at its head office location at Carlton House Terrace in central London. The Society also operates a conferencing business managed by the Head of Conferencing which allows third parties to book events at the Royal Society.
The Internal Event Planner is a member of the conferencing team and their role is to manage and coordinate the Royal Society events that take place at the Royal Society in chargeable meeting rooms.
The Internal Event Planner will meet with clients, work with them to plan their event in detail and book all related Royal Society services such as room logistics, catering and audio visual services. This involves logging and following up enquiries, providing event solutions and quotations to internal clients The Internal Event Planner will then ensure that all information is recorded accurately and communicated to everyone involved in the delivery of the event.
The role will suit an individual who would like to work as part of a small, busy team but who enjoys meeting new people as well as building relationships with clients over time. It will suit someone who has good interpersonal and communication skills, multitasking skills, presentation skills and excellent attention to detail.
